In recent years, the vaping phenomenon has taken the Philippines by storm. Once a niche market, vaping has evolved into a mainstream lifestyle choice for many Filipinos. This article delves into the reasons behind this surge in popularity, the demographic landscape of vape users, and the implications for public health and regulation.
One of the primary drivers of the vaping trend in the Philippines is the perception of vaping as a safer alternative to traditional smoking. Many people, especially the youth, are drawn to the variety of flavors and the customizable experience that vaping offers. Unlike conventional cigarettes, which have a singular, often unpleasant taste, vape products provide an array of flavors—from fruity to dessert-like options—that appeal to a broader audience. This appeal is particularly potent among younger generations, who are more inclined to experiment with contemporary lifestyle choices.
Moreover, the social aspect of vaping cannot be overlooked. Vaping lounges and shops have sprouted across urban areas, offering a communal space for enthusiasts to share their experiences and bond over their preference for vaping. Events such as vape competitions have further solidified this community, allowing users to showcase their skills and creativity in cloud chasing and flavor combinations. This vibrant culture has transformed vaping into a social activity, distinct from the solitary nature often associated with traditional smoking.
However, while the vaping trend continues to gain momentum, it is essential to consider the potential health implications. Although vaping is often marketed as a less harmful alternative, research is ongoing to understand its long-term effects. Reports of health issues linked to vaping have raised concerns among health officials and consumer advocates. The government faces the challenge of balancing regulation to ensure public safety while also acknowledging the rights of consumers who choose to vape.
